What is Alexa+?
Alexa+ is Amazon’s enhanced AI assistant. The program has been beta tested by millions of users since its announcement in early February 2025. Alexa+ combines the ease and convenience of the classic Alexa voice assistant with AI for an assistant capable of more complicated tasks.
What’s different from the standard Alexa is that you don’t actually need an Amazon Smart Home Echo device to use it. You can now access Alexa+ on the web or through the Alexa app.

Prime members now get Alexa+ for free
So, do you have to pay for Alexa+? Not if you’re a Prime member. AI Assistant is now included as a Prime benefit. If you’re not a Prime member, you can still use Alexa+’s chat feature for free on Alexa.com, but that’s it. If you want all the benefits of Alexa+ and you’re not a Prime member, you can pay $19.99 per month for access. However, since the Prime membership only costs $14.99 per month, just sign up for Prime because you’ll get additional benefits outside of Alexa+.
What can Alexa+ do?
Alexa+ takes Alexa to the next level. Alexa+ can be used anywhere with its web services and app, compared to Alexa, which can be accessed through Echo devices. It has a chatbot feature where you can ask it all life questions. It also helps you stay more organized by planning meals, booking repairs, and managing calendars. It will also help you plan trips and parties, write emails, create workout plans, and control your smart home devices.
